Woody's has it all, food, drinks, sports, dancing and a guranteed good time. Really popular with all ages, but you can be sure to find a lot of 21st birthday or bachelorette celebrations here. On the weekends it can get really packed and the dancefloor is never short of impeccable drunk dancing. There are 3 levels, including a large rooftop that is open during warmer weather. Woody's is a diner and dance bar, offering burgers, pizza, salads, and several Mexican dishes. Open daily until at least midnight.

In addition to fine dining on the first floor of the restaurant, Woody's has a second floor and a rooftop patio. Families can dine on the ground floor while patrons age 21 and over can enjoy cocktails on the rooftop overlooking the view of downtown Royal Oak.
